Output f3c89e1956b0032d9883b83984561365faab1649531aa695062b19ece72fc95a:7

value
86777000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ec152f7a1cecd8561e07377af44d22e24955bbfe OP_EQUAL
address
3PDJmomKQz8nEcEzQvxwENuhqsiBGxkSA9
transaction
f3c89e1956b0032d9883b83984561365faab1649531aa695062b19ece72fc95a
spent
true